Newquay AFC extended their lead at the top, local hockey teams delivered high-scoring performances, and two Newquay Hornets players starred for Cornwall U20s in a standout weekend of sport.
Newquay AFC extend lead at the top with dominant win over Liskeard
Newquay AFC strengthened their grip on the South West Peninsula Premier West title with a convincing 3-0 victory over closest rivals Liskeard Athletic at Mount Wise.
In front of a bumper crowd, Louis Price struck twice, either side of a goal from Tom Shepherd, as the Peppermints moved nine points clear at the top of the table.
St Piran League Action...
In the St Piran League Premier Division East, St Mawgan secured a 3-0 win at Polperro to keep the pressure on the top three. Meanwhile, St Newlyn East remain top of Division One East after an emphatic 6-1 victory at Lifton.
Win and draw for Newquay hockey teams...
Newquay’s first hockey team produced a dominant display, defeating Devonport Services 7-3 at home to move up to third in Division One South. The second team drew 4-4 with visiting Bude.
Newquay Hornets duo shine for Cornwall U20s
Newquay Hornets players Rhys Bowery and Lowen Mears-Ollerenshaw had the honour of representing Cornwall Under-20s in their midweek victory over Camborne School of Mines. The young Cornish side claimed a 45-15 win at Hayle, with both players playing key roles. They will hope to be involved again when Cornwall take on a Cornwall Clubs XV at St Austell on February 26.
